Vassar Women's Soccer Notes - Western Connecticut

POUGHKEEPSIE, NY (September 5, 2017) – The Vassar College women's soccer team continues its home stand with a midweek matchup against Western Connecticut State on Wednesday, September 6 at 4:00 p.m. on Gordon Field.

Last Time Out: The Brewers lost 2-0 on a rainy Sunday afternoon to NYU. The Violets started the scoring early with a chip shot over the head of goalkeeper Fiona Walsh in the seventh minute. Out of the break, the Violet pressure continued and finally broke through the Vassar defense for a second goal. Walsh made a terrific save, but was unable to control the rebound and Charlie Herbertz of NYU collected the ball and put it in the back of the net to give her squad a 2-0 advantage in the 77th minute.

A Look At The Brewers (0-1-1)
  • Freshmen Ashley Ferry and Fiona Walsh have led the Brewers thus far on offense and defense respectively.
  • Ferry leads the team with three points after notching a goal and an assist in her debut against Montclair State.
  • Fiona Walsh has started both games in net for the Brewers, playing all 200 minutes while colleting 10 saves.
  • Savannah Cutler came off the bench in Friday's outing and knocked in the second Vassar goal in the 54th minute.
  • Dahlia Chroscinski is the third Brewer with a point on this young season as she recorded an assist in the game against Montclair State.
  • Vassar's leading returning goal scorer from a season ago, Audrey Pillsbury, has yet to find the back of the net in 2017, but leads the team with five shots.

A Look At The Colonials (2-0-0)
  • West Conn. earned two wins at the Engineers Cup hosted by RPI during the opening weekend of the season.
  • On Friday, September 1, the Colonials shutout the hosts 2-0 and then on Saturday, the squad shutout Buffalo State 3-0.
  • Junior Allison Oakley and senior Andrew DeVoe are tied for the team lead with two goals each.
  • Senior Autumn Sorice leads the Colonials with two assists.
  • Senior goalkeeper Jillian Fernandez has played the full 180 minutes for West Conn. this season, posting six saves and two shutouts with two wins.

Against Western Connecticut All-Time: Vassar is 3-8-0 all-time against the Colonials dating back to 1994. Last season, West Conn. won on September 7 in Poughkeepsie, 2-1.

Next Up: The Brewers play a pair of matches this weekend as part of the VC Invitational. On Saturday, Vassar takes on Mount Saint Mary at 11:00 a.m. and on Sunday, the team will match up with Elmira at 2:00 p.m.
